Olá pessoal,
Gostaria que alguém me ajudasse, pois estou com dúvidas sob a licença do Java, existe alguma especificação sobre isso?
Preciso saber para apresentar em um trabalho acadêmico.
Grato pessoal.
att,
Augusto
Olá pessoal,
Gostaria que alguém me ajudasse, pois estou com dúvidas sob a licença do Java, existe alguma especificação sobre isso?
Preciso saber para apresentar em um trabalho acadêmico.
Grato pessoal.
att,
Augusto
Bom dia,
13 Nov 2006 ; Sun Open Sources Java Platform and Releases Source Code Under GPL License Via NetBeans and Java.net Communities …
Sun Microsystem, the creator and leading advocate of Java™ technology, today(13 Nov 2006) announce it is releasing its implementations of Java technology as free software under the GNU General Public License version two (GPLv2). Available today, are the first pieces of source code for Sun’s implementation of Java Platform Standard Edition (Java SE) and a buildable implementation of Java Platform Micro Edition (Java ME). Details are available at http://www.sun.com/opensource/java. In addition, Sun is adding the GPLv2 license to Java Platform Enterprise Edition (Java EE), which has been available for over a year under the Common Development and Distribution License (CDDL) through Project GlassFish™ at http://glassfish.dev.java.net.
http://technology.findlaw.com/articles/01135/010405.html
http://www.sun.com/software/opensource/java/
Em resumo de : http://java.developpez.com/annonces/open-sourcing-java/
Data : 13 Nov 2006
* Java SE, Java ME e Java EE estão agora disponíveis sob a licença GPLv2
* Sun acrescentou uma exceção Classpath, como a licença permite, permitindo que qualquer pessoa para executar programas em Java sob a licença da sua escolha
* Eles também continuarão a estar disponíveis na licença de negócio atual
* Glassfish é licenciado GPLv2 e CDDL
* Estão agora disponíveis em código aberto:
- Tecnologia HotSpot,
- O compilador Java,
- Utilitário e JavaHelp
* Sun JDK espera fornecer uma "Edificabilidade" para o 1 º trimestre 2007
* O projeto é chamado OpenJDK
* Haverá, necessariamente, passar o TCK para usar o nome Java
* O TCK é licenciado Open Source
* A JCP está no lugar. E continuam a ser usada para adicionar funcionalidade para plataformas Java
* Ele vai assinar um Acordo de Contribuição Sun, se você quiser que o código a ser integrado no JDK / JRE
* O código fonte será primeiro disponível através do Subversion ler mais tarde através Mercurial
* O código fonte está disponível como projetos do NetBeans.
* 2 endereços:
http://sun.com/opensource/java
http://openjdk.java.net/
Best regards
Opa…
Muito Obrigado, resolveu meu problema.
Abraços
Bom dia,
Para completar a informação sobre o licenciamento do Java EE.
GlassFish é a implementação de referencia de Java EE :
The majority of GlassFish v2 code is available under a Dual License consisting of the Common Development and Distribution License (CDDL) v1.0 and GNU Public License (GPL) v2 for both the source and binary forms.
http://wiki.java.net/bin/view/Projects/GlassFishCodeDependencies
Observe alguns módulos têm uma licença Apache outros CDDL + GPLv2.
Por exemplo JXTA.jar (licença Apache) e shoal-gms.jar (GPLv2 + CDDL)
Abraços
Que eu saiba a única restrição quanto ao uso de java é em usinas nucleares e coisas do tipo.
Olhem que engraçado:
http://www.goldb.org/goldblog/2006/12/12/JavaInNuclearReactors.aspx